May 2025 - Apr 2026Rodfords Mead area has the 8th highest crime rate of 49 local areas in Hengrove and Whitchurch Park , and the 407th highest crime rate of 1,343 local areas in Bristol, City of .
Crime levels at this postcode are much higher than in the adjoining streets, suggesting that most neighbouring areas are relatively safer than this one.
The overall crime rate in the area around Rodfords Mead (BS14 9UD) in the last 12 months was 147.1 per 1,000 residents and was 22.7% higher than the Hengrove and Whitchurch Park average (119.9 per 1,000 residents). In the last 12 months, this area’s most reported crimes were Violence and sexual offences with 20 offences recorded. The least common crime was Drugs with 1 case , unchanged from 2025. The fastest-growing crime category was Other crime ( 100.0% YoY). The sharpest decline was Bicycle theft ( -50.0% YoY).
Violent crimes totalled 26 (≈ 70.8 per 1,000 residents). Year-over-year these were rising ( 52.9% ). Over the last decade, overall crime has falling ( -56.3% comparing early vs recent averages) .
In the area around Rodfords Mead (BS14 9UD), the highest concentration of overall crime is near Griggfield Walk, where police recorded 38 incidents. Violent and public-order offences occur most often near Parsons Paddock (22 offences). Both locations lie within roughly 0.3 miles of this postcode area.
